Direct Cash Transfer (BLT) is one of the Indonesian government's initiatives that aims to provide direct financial support to the community, especially vulnerable groups, in the face of difficult economic conditions. BLT functions as a social safety net to fulfill basic needs and reduce economic burden during times of crisis, such as during the COVID-19 pandemic. Through this research, the author analyzes the role of BLT in strengthening the social security system in Indonesia. This research uses an interview-based qualitative approach and literature study, which provides in-depth insights into the effectiveness of BLT in improving the welfare of vulnerable communities. The results show that BLT not only helps fulfill basic needs, but also increases purchasing power and social resilience. However, improvements in the distribution and supervision of the program are still needed so that its impact can be optimal and sustainable.

This study aims to describe and analyze the discourse structure consisting of macro structure, supra structure, micro structure, and discourse contained in Shopee  and Blibli online shopping advertisements. The object of the research is the transcript of online shopping advertisements from Shopee  and Blibli. The data collection methods used were advertising observation and doing advertising transcripts so that the final data used was in the form of text. This data was then analyzed using a qualitative descriptive analysis model of Teun A Van Dijk's discourse analysis theory. From the data studied, the results of the study showed that (1) the macro structure or theme in the transcript of online shopping ads was seen in the entire content. The themes were big discounts, free shipping, cash back bonuses and discount vouchers. (2) The super structure consisted of (a) an introduction to the issue, (b) a series of arguments, (c) a statement of invitation, (d) a reaffirmation. (3) Microstructure consists of (a) background, (b) details, (c) meaning, (d) coherence marker, (e) stylistic, (f) rhetoric, (g) graphic use. (4) The discourse contained in the text was a persuasive discourse.

In the current era of information technology, easy and efficient transaction management is an important requirement in the business world, both small and large scale. Rumah Makan Mie Happy is a medium-scale culinary business. Happy Noodle Restaurant provides noodle-based preparations. In its daily life, Happy Noodle Restaurant can serve around 100 consumers, so that the service process requires speed to serve consumers. But in fact, Mie Happy Restaurant still uses manual data processing and transaction management, so it often experiences problems such as slow payment processes, frequent loss of receipts or proof of payment, difficulty in recapitulating or reporting transactions both daily and monthly, and frequent errors in the calculation process. From the problems experienced by Mie Happy Restaurant, the author is interested in developing a web-based cashier application that can help in all matters related to transaction management at Mie Happy Restaurant. The research conducted aims to build or develop a cashier application for Happy Noodle Restaurant that can improve the efficiency and effectiveness of transaction management. This cashier application was built or developed using Hypertext Markup Language (HTML) and Hypertext Preprocessor (PHP) with Visual Studio Code editor and MySQL Database Management System (DBMS). The results of testing with black box testing show that the cashier application developed in functionality has run as expected. This web-based cashier application provides convenience for admins and increases the effectiveness and efficiency of operational activities.

Digitalization in the payment system has brought significant changes in people's behavior, including among generation Z (Gen-Z). One of the most prominent innovations is the Quick Response Code Indonesian Standard (QRIS), which offers convenience, speed, and accessibility in transactions. This study aims to analyze the impact of implementing QRIS payments on the financial planning culture of Gen-Z, known as the digital native generation. This study uses a quantitative approach with a survey method on a number of respondents from Gen-Z. The results of the study show that the use of QRIS has positive and negative impacts on their financial planning habits. On the one hand, QRIS makes it easier to manage daily financial transactions, such as automatic recording and easy cashless payments. On the other hand, this convenience also has the potential to increase consumptive behavior due to too fast access and minimal direct control over spending. This study highlights the importance of financial education to increase Gen-Z's awareness in using technology wisely to support better financial planning.

PT X is a company in the field of national project construction. PT X's operational activities are sales of goods and installation services. The method used is descriptive qualitative. Cash receipts by PT X begin with the receipt of purchases of goods by the cashier which will then be submitted to the sales department to be recorded. The sales department will submit to the warehouse department. While cash disbursements begin with employees submitting checks as proof of expenditure to the cashier and then will be processed by the accounting staff. PT X's cash receipt accounting system is in accordance with the theory that requires cash receipts to have sales functions, cash functions, shipping functions, and accounting functions in them. In addition, PT X's cash disbursements are also in accordance with the theory that requires cash disbursements to have cash functions and accounting functions in them.

Payment system developments brought about by technological advancements to date have resulted in a variety of cashless transactions, including card-based and application-based (server) electronic money. Bank Indonesia launched QRIS (Quick Response Code Indonesian Standard), an application-based non-cash payment system that addresses community demands. Finding out how perceived ease of use and security affect QRIS usage decisions in the Lampung Province Community is the goal of this study. This study is quantitative and employs a survey approach, distributing a questionnaire to 140 Lampung Province residents who have used QRIS to make payments. The study's findings suggest that decisions about usage are significantly influenced by perceivedease of use and security in transactions.

This study aims to analyze the effect of gross profit on the prediction of operating cash flow at PT. Unilever Indonesia. Gross profit is calculated as the difference between revenue and cost of goods sold, including cash and credit sales, indicating the potential cash inflows expected from customers in the future. The study uses a quantitative method with secondary data obtained from PT. Unilever Indonesia's official website. The results show gross profit significantly impacts the company's operating cash flow prediction. Over the last five years, PT. Unilever Indonesia’s gross profit has increased by an average of 2% per year since 2019. Meanwhile, operating cash flow, calculated from customer receipts and various operational payments, shows fluctuations, with a 3% increase in 2019 and 2021 but only a 1% increase in 2022-2023. This decrease is due to differences in the payment of remuneration to directors and employees, which affects cash flow. These findings highlight the importance of gross profit in predicting operating cash flow in the future.
